Missha is the South Korean cosmetics company founded by Seo Young-pil in 2000 as the online platform Beautynet, opened on the premise that mass-market cosmetics did not need their inflated price tags. The first physical Missha shop opened in 2002 near Ewha Women's University in Seoul, and the chain became one of the founding brands of Korea's road-shop boom. Missha's reputation rests on skincare and BB cream — the M Perfect Cover BB Cream is a category landmark — but the catalog includes a small fragrance line distributed through the same retail footprint of roughly 30,000 points of sale globally. The perfumes are budget-tier, skin-close florals and clean musks aligned with Korean beauty rather than European structural perfumery. The brand is now operated by Able C&C Co., Ltd.
